Staples nominates Curtis Feeny, Deb Henretta and John Lindgren for election to its Board of Directors

– USA, MA – Staples, Inc. (Nasdaq: SPLS) today announced the nomination of three new Directors. Curtis Feeny, Managing Director of Voyager Capital, Deb Henretta, former Group President of Global e-Commerce at Procter & Gamble and John Lundgren,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of Stanley Black & Decker, have been nominated by the company’s Board of Directors for election at the 2016 Annual Meeting.

“I’m pleased that we are nominating three highly qualified individuals to join our Board of Directors,” said Vijay Vishwanath, Chair of Staples’ Nominating and Corporate Governance Committee. “Curtis, Deb, and John each bring fresh perspectives and a wealth of diverse experiences, and we are excited to welcome them to our Board.”

Feeny has been Managing Director of Voyager Capital since January 2000. In 2001, he was appointed by President George W. Bush to the Board of Directors of the Presidio Trust, where he served until 2006. From 1992 through 1999, Feeny served as Executive Vice President of Stanford Management Co., which manages the Stanford University endowment.

Henretta currently serves as Senior Advisor to SSA & Company, an executive strategy consulting firm. She spent 30 years at Procter & Gamble. In 2005, Henretta was appointed President of the company’s business in ASEAN, Australia and India. She was appointed group president, Procter & Gamble Asia in 2007, group president of the company’s Global Beauty Sector in June 2013, and group president of Procter & Gamble E-Business in February 2015. Henretta retired from Procter & Gamble in June 2015.

Lundgren is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of Stanley Black & Decker, Inc., the successor entity following the merger of The Stanley Works and Black and Decker in March 2010. Prior to the merger, he served as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of The Stanley Works, a worldwide supplier of consumer products, industrial tools and security solutions for professional, industrial and consumer use. During his tenure, sales have grown from approximately $2 billion to approximately $11 billion in 2015, and he successfully diversified the company’s strategy. Prior to joining The Stanley Works in 2004, Lundgren served as President — European Consumer Products, of Georgia Pacific Corporation and also held various positions in finance, manufacturing, corporate development and strategic planning with Georgia Pacific and its predecessor companies.

Rowland Moriarty and Basil Anderson plan to retire from Staples’ Board of Directors at the 2016 Annual Meeting after 30 and 19 years of service respectively. Raul Vazquez will not stand for reelection to the company’s Board at the 2016 Annual Meeting.

“I’d like to thank Row, Basil, and Raul for their commitment and many contributions to Staples,” said Ron Sargent, Chairman and Chief Executive Officer, Staples, Inc. “With over 50 years of combined service on our Board, their dedication and expertise has been invaluable.”
